An old 1st gen 12V ran before i got there and made over 500, on a VE pump! He blew an I/C boot on the run.
After a bit, a newer dodge common rail truck rolled up to the dyno and put down +-650hp and the torque i dont remmember, pretty stout for a dodge, guess he had a 77mm turbo and some other goodies. After A while the shop owner decided to run his dodge, also a common rail truck, had dual fuelers, intake plate, horn, heater delete, banks intercooler, 2 stage NX, header and iirc a 74mm S400! He had a hard time gettin it to light the turbo on the rollers and kept fallin off the charger, once he got that sucker lit, it spun the rollers to iirc
805HP @ over 1800LB fuel only! The spray wasnt hooked up. Man that turbo is a screamer! He ran out of fuel at the top of dyno run and it started to surge/bark and had some guys ducking for cover!
